---### 台湾区块链钱包系统解析与应用前景随着区块链技术的不断进步,数字货币的普及力度也在逐渐加大。区块链钱...
比特币作为一种重要的数字货币,其钱包地址在交易中扮演着至关重要的角色。本文将全面解析比特币钱包地址的位数、组成、生成方式及其对用户的意义,帮助读者更好地理解和使用比特币。
比特币钱包地址是一个字符串,类似于银行账户号码,用于接收和发送比特币。用户通过这个地址进行转账,因此准确理解钱包地址的构成和特性至关重要。比特币地址通常是以字母和数字的组合形式出现,其长度常在26到35个字符之间,具体长度依赖于所使用的编码格式。
比特币钱包地址主要有三种编码格式:P2PKH(Pay to Public Key Hash)、P2SH(Pay to Script Hash)以及Bech32(SegWit地址)。每种地址类型在编码方式和位数上都有所不同。
比特币钱包地址是通过复杂的加密算法生成的。一般来说,每个用户在创建钱包时,系统会自动生成一个私钥和相对应的公共地址。私钥是保密的,用于钱包的安全访问,而公共地址是可以公开分享的。
至关重要的是,私钥一定要妥善保管,一旦丢失,用户将永远无法访问其钱包中的比特币。此外,用户应避免在不安全的环境下生成和存储比特币地址,以减少被盗风险。
在比特币网络中,每个交易都需要用到钱包地址,因此,用户在进行任何转账或收款操作时,总是需要提供相应的地址。值得注意的是,虽然地址具有唯一性,但用户可以创建多个地址来管理自己的比特币资产,增加隐私性和安全性。
不同类型的钱包(如硬件钱包、软件钱包、纸质钱包等)都可以生成不同格式的钱包地址,用户可根据自己的需求选择合适的钱包类型。
关于比特币钱包地址,人们通常会有很多疑问。以下是五个常见的问题及其详细解答:
比特币钱包地址主要有三种格式:P2PKH、P2SH和Bech32。P2PKH地址以“1”开头,长度通常为34个字符,用于最传统的比特币交易;P2SH地址以“3”开头,支持更复杂的脚本功能,长短和P2PKH类似;而Bech32地址以“bc1”开头,支持隔离见证(SegWit)交易,能够减少交易费用且提高确认速度。
选择不同格式的钱包地址可能会影响到交易费用和效率,因此在创建地址时,用户应考虑其使用场景。例如,如果用户频繁进行比特币交易,选择Bech32或P2SH地址能更有效地减少成本。
比特币钱包地址的长度之所以不同,主要是由于其编码方式与所支持功能的差异。传统的P2PKH和P2SH地址通常为34个字符,而Bech32地址则由于其支持更复杂的功能及更加强大的脚本,因此其长度可以在42到62个字符之间。字符长度的变化主要是为了确保地址的唯一性及其安全性。
此外,较长的地址在一定程度上也减少了地址冲突的可能性,尤其是在大规模交易环境下。而短地址,虽然更为简洁,但相对更易出现碰撞,安全性水平降低。综合来看,用户在使用不同长度的地址时,应该充分理解其背后的原理与使用场景。
验证比特币钱包地址的有效性可以通过检查地址的格式和校验和(Checksum)来进行。一般来说,标准的比特币地址在格式上应符合特定模式,如P2PKH以“1”开头,而P2SH则以“3”开头。
用户可以通过多种在线工具及钱包软件自行验证地址的有效性。具体流程包括对输入的比特币地址进行格式校验,确保其符合标准的字符串长度,以及使用Base58Check编码技术进行checksum校验,保证地址的准确性。
此外,用户在输入地址时及时检查拼写错误,以避免将资金发送到错误地址,这对资金安全至关重要。
生成多个钱包地址主要出于安全与隐私的考虑。在使用比特币进行交易时,使用可追溯的主地址会暴露用户的交易活动,而经常更换钱包地址可以帮助提高交易隐私性。这样做还可以更便利地管理资产。
同时,每生成一笔新的交易,用户可以选择新生成的地址接收资金,这不仅能方便资金区分,也降低了因地址被泄露而发生的安全风险。此外,某些钱包还支持将不同的地址分配给不同的金额或用途(如支出、收入等),帮助用户更清晰地管理资金。
一旦丢失私钥,用户将无法找回比特币,这是比特币设计之中的一部分。比特币的安全性建立在去中心化和匿名性之上,私钥丢失意味着该钱包的权限将永远丧失。
为了防范这种情况,用户在创建钱包时应该做到妥善备份私钥及恢复助记词,避免因意外情况导致的经济损失。此外,专业的硬件钱包和软件钱包在技术上也提供了较为完善的备份功能,用户应确保在任何时候都能够安全地访问自己的私钥。
若私钥损失不可复得,则用户可能需要接受仅能通过将比特币出售或转换为其他资产的方法来弥补损失。
本文旨在帮助用户了解比特币钱包地址的重要性及相关操作,希望可以帮助读者在比特币投资与交易中更加谨慎和安全。